WISCONSIN OFF ROAD SERIES
AMERICAʼS LARGEST STATE MOUNTAIN BIKE RACE SERIES
Now in itʼs 19th season, WORS averages over 600 racers and 800 spectators per event at each of our 12 distinct venues throughout Wisconsin. With our focus on racer and spectator fun, WORS never fails to provide a high quality, family-friendly weekend for recreational and competitive cyclists alike. Competition. WORS continues to draw and create top national-level racers from the region and beyond. With races for all ages and abilities, WORS provides out-standing competitive challenges for Pro-fessional MTB racers, 6-year old weekend warriors, and everyone in between.Fun. WORS events are planned with equal care for recreational riders. WORS weekends are social and family events, as well as races, and our goal is to create access to mountain biking for as many individuals as possible.
WORS continues to focus on creat-ing the ultimate environment for as many mountain bikers as possible to explore their potential through safe, fun, friendly competition.

WORS SUBARU CUP PRO XCTThe Subaru Cup will be one of five premier mountain bike race events held in America during the 2010 racing season. North America’s top male and female racers,
including those who represented the United
States and Canada in the 2008 Summer
Games in Beijing, will compete at the Subaru
Cup to qualify for the 2010 National Champion-
ships and 2012 Olympics.
Outstanding spectator turnout is a hallmark
of events hosted by the Wisconsin Off Road
Series, and the 2010 Subaru Cup will be the
highlight of the 2010 Midwest mountain bike
racing season.
WORS is America’s largest state mountain
bike racing series, and in addition to the Pro
races, the Subaru Cup will host a full slate of
amateur racing with ability categories and age
classes for everyone. The Subaru Cup will also
be the major cycling industry gathering of the
summer for the Midwest and include demos,
displays, and free gifts for those in
attendance. WORS and WORS sponsors will
offer a full slate of festival activities including
tours of the race course, wake boarding,
onsite camping, food and entertainment,
and much more:
Pro Short Track. A cross between a criterium, BMX, cyclo-cross and single-track, the Short Track race is super fast and spectator friendly. The Subaru Cup will host a Pro Short Track event on June 27, with cash prizes for Pro men and women.
An Industry Challenge will offer those whose career path includes “live, breath and ride bikes,” the chance to compete for company and industry bragging rights.
Perched at the crossroads of several technical descents and climbs, WORS benefactors in the VIP Hospitality tent will enjoy the best seat in the house, with race commentary from WORS ambassadors, refreshments, and company that always knows how to pick the right gear.
WORS will be coordinating with local MTB enthusiasts and sponsors to make sure that the famously great festival atmosphere of Midwest MTB racing is up to expectations, and up late, at the Subaru Cup After Party.
The National MTB series has not raced in the Midwest for almost a decade. WORS is com-mitted to making the Subaru Cup Pro XCT an
outstanding event in the national series, and for MTB enthusiasts of all levels! We hope to see you there.
